MAC通过L2TP连接公司内部VPN网络

由于疫情原因很多人都在居家办公,分享一下mac连接公司VPN的办法

1.系统偏好设置-->网络

2.点击加号增加VPN

3.填写服务器配置地址为VPN Server 的IP地址或者域名,输入正确的VPN登录账户名称,点击认证设置进行密码认证相关配置

4.用户认证按照服务器配置的认证方式进行选择,我这里配置的为密码认证方式,填写VPN登录密码,机器认证可以按章服务器配置进行配置,我这里没有设置共享密钥,值为空

5.由于MAC OS不支持无密钥方式连接L2TP协议的VPN,需要在VPN配置文件中/etc/ppp/options中添加一下配置参数

plugin.L2TP.ppp

l2tpnoipsec

6.在网络中设置VPN顺序为一

7.VPN配置完成后需要手动添加路由信息,才可以访问VPN server的内网IP,不添加只能访问到对端网关,VPN拨号成功后会自动添加路由条数,需要修改/etc/ppp/ip-up来实现。(具体路由具体配置) 

/sbin/route add 192.168.110.0 -interface $1

/sbin/route add 192.168.111.0 -interface $1

/sbin/route add 192.168.107.0 -interface $1

 其中$1个人理解为所设置的网络出口的选项,在第6条已经修改了VPN为首选项,所以就直接写的$1

8.修改ip-up的权限

chmod 755  /etc/ppp/ip-up

9.为VPN设置DNS,这里可以配置成通用网络服务的DNS:8.8.8.8

 10.重新电脑或者wifi或网线

11.VPN连接

有可能会出现能ping通,但是就是没网的情况,可以执行下面两行代码:

sudo sysctl net.link.generic.system.hwcksum_tx=0

sudo sysctl net.link.generic.system.hwcksum_rx=0

先终端执行这两个然后再连vpn就行了,使用完后设置回来 参数该成1就行

参考:MacOS 软件版本更新Monterey12.1版之后L2TP无法正常访问内网服务解决方案_Carlton Xu的博客-CSDN博客_mac无法访问内网地址

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值